加入收藏 | 设为首页 | 会员中心 | 我要投稿 百客网 - 域百科网 (https://www.yubaike.com.cn/)- 数据工具、云安全、建站、站长网、数据计算!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

MySQL事务控制与站长无障碍设计实战

发布时间:2026-05-04 11:43:00 所属栏目:MySql教程 来源:DaWei
导读:  MySQL事务控制是数据库操作中确保数据一致性和完整性的关键机制。在Web开发中,尤其是在站长进行网站后台管理时,合理使用事务可以有效避免因操作失败导致的数据不一致问题。  事务是一组SQL语句的集合,这些语

  MySQL事务控制是数据库操作中确保数据一致性和完整性的关键机制。在Web开发中,尤其是在站长进行网站后台管理时,合理使用事务可以有效避免因操作失败导致的数据不一致问题。


  事务是一组SQL语句的集合,这些语句要么全部执行成功,要么全部回滚。例如,在用户注册过程中,需要同时插入用户信息和生成用户账户,如果其中一步失败,整个操作应该撤销,以保持数据的一致性。


  在MySQL中,事务通过BEGIN、COMMIT和ROLLBACK命令进行控制。当执行BEGIN后,后续的SQL语句会被视为一个事务块,直到执行COMMIT或ROLLBACK为止。这种机制使得站长在处理复杂业务逻辑时更加安全。


  对于站长而言,无障碍设计不仅仅是界面友好,也包括数据库操作的稳定性。在设计网站功能时,应考虑事务的使用场景,比如订单处理、资金转账等关键操作,必须确保事务的正确执行。


  事务还支持嵌套和保存点,这为更复杂的业务流程提供了灵活性。例如,在处理多步骤表单提交时,可以设置保存点,以便在某个步骤出错时仅回滚到该保存点,而不是整个事务。


  在实际应用中,站长需要根据业务需求选择合适的事务隔离级别,以平衡数据一致性与系统性能。不同的隔离级别会影响并发操作的行为,进而影响用户体验。


AI生成的示意图,仅供参考

  站长个人见解,掌握MySQL事务控制不仅能提升数据库操作的可靠性,还能为网站的稳定运行提供保障。站长在设计系统时,应充分考虑事务的应用,以实现更高效的无障碍管理。

(编辑:百客网 - 域百科网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章